A replacement key from a dealer will generally cost between $280 to $475. This is in addition to the cost of programming the key to your vehicle. You can save money if you purchase the key through an outside source, such as an online retailer or locksmith. A locksmith may not be able to program a replacement key for your car.

Some dealerships in the automotive industry require you to go to them for a new key fob since they have the required programming equipment. This is particularly true for European cars, says CR's Yu. Some Volkswagen dealers, for instance will not program key fobs aftermarket.

Modern Audi key fobs aren't solely used to lock and unlock doors, but also to start the vehicle. This is because they come with an immobilizer chip. While you can locate an replacement key on the internet, it's important to check the compatibility of the key with your vehicle before you buy it.

Depending on what type of Audi car you own, it could have a traditional turn-in-the ignition key or a remote with a transponder. Both kinds of keys can be replaced by professional locksmiths or dealerships. However the process of replacing the Audi key fob is more difficult than replacing an ordinary key. The key fob is fitted with a specific electronic system that needs to be reprogrammed to perform as intended. This can only be done by a qualified dealer or a certified locksmith.

You may have a keyfob remote to unlock your doors and start your engine if you have an advanced Audi. These advanced key fobs require a specific programming procedure that is only available at the dealer. In certain instances you may have to have your vehicle's computer programmed to work with the new key fob. Fortunately, Audi owners can save time and money by using an auto locksmith instead of a dealer to replace damaged or lost keys to their car.

While Audi dealers are able to make replacement keys for you, it will take some check here time to receive them from Germany. Audi must first enter the immobiliser code into their database before they can provide you with a functioning key. You'll be stuck without a key to click here open the doors or start the car.
